Model MiNi034 load cells are designed to this “S-type”and manufactured from high quality aluminum alloy of aviation standard. LAS-A load cells can be used to measure loads range from 2kg to 100kg with the measuring accuracy of 0.03% R.O.( R.O.=Rated Output) and 2mV/V output signal.
MiNi034 load cells are mainly used for crane scales,hopper scales,tensile testing,test benches and machine testing.

Technical Data:

Model MiNi034 Excitation,Recommended 5-12VDC
Rated Capacity 2/5/10/20/30/50/100kg Excitation,Maximum 18VDC
Accuracy Class B Operating Temp.Range -20-+60℃
Rated Output 2.0±10%mV/V Safe Overload 150%R.C.
Zero Balance ±2%R.O. Ultimate Overload 200%R.C.
Input Resistance 395±10Ω Insulation Resistance ≥2000MΩ(50VDC)
Output Resistance 350±5Ω Cable,Length ø0.8mm×0.5m*
Linearlty Error ±0.03%R.O. Protection Class IP65
Repeatability Error ±0.02%R.O. Temp.Effect on Output ±0.05%R.O./10℃
Hysteresis Error ±0.02%R.O. Temp.Effect on Zero ±0.05%R.O./10℃
Creep in 30 Min. ±0.03%R.O. Compensated Temp.Range -10-+40℃
